  • Understanding the Health Risks of Radon

    Although you can't see or smell it, radon is a harmful radioactive gas that occurs naturally from the decay of uranium in soil and rock formations. When radon leaks into your house, it can concentrate in the indoor air, especially in lower levels like crawl spaces or basements. Prolonged exposure to elevated radon levels poses significant health risks, as radon is the primary cause of lung cancer among individuals who have never smoked. You should know that even minimal concentrations of radon in indoor air can be harmful over time, because the gas emits radioactive particles that injure lung tissue when breathed in.     Common Sources of Radon across Sainte Rose, Bathurst, and Miramichi areas

    A primary source of radon in Sainte Rose, Bathurst, and Miramichi stems from the natural decomposition of uranium in the underlying soil and rock. When uranium decomposes, it produces radon gas, which can penetrate through foundation cracks, gaps around pipes, or exposed flooring. Once inside, radon concentrates in your indoor air, specifically in lower levels of your home where ventilation is restricted. Poorly designed and upkeep of ventilation systems can increase the problem, as they might not clear out radon-laden air efficiently. You must monitor areas where the ground joins your home's structure, as these locations are particularly susceptible.     The Testing Process: A Homeowner's Overview

    Before starting radon testing, it's essential to recognize that the process requires careful planning and strict adherence to safety protocols. If you own a home, you should understand standard testing procedures to obtain accurate results. Technicians usually recommend placing a detector in the lowest living area of your home, not near moisture, air currents, or sunshine. Depending on the selected approach—short-term or long-term—testing equipment remains from a few days to several months.

    You must ensure normal closed-house conditions, which involves closing all windows and external doors to the extent possible during the test.     Will Your New Brunswick Home Insurance Cover Radon Testing?

    If you're curious about insurance coverage for radon testing in New Brunswick, it's important to understand that most standard homeowners' insurance policies exclude radon testing or mitigation. Standard insurance coverage usually exclude coverage for testing procedures and harm from long-term radon exposure, since insurance companies consider it a maintenance or environmental issue. You should examine your policy details and reach out to your insurance provider to confirm what coverage, if any, are available for radon-related concerns.

    What's the Typical Timeframe for Radon Test Results?

    When carrying out a radon test, the testing period usually spans from 48 hours for quick assessments to 90 days or greater for extended monitoring. Following the test duration, results delivery varies by the testing approach—digital devices provide instant readings, while lab-analyzed kits usually take 1 to 2 weeks.     Will High Radon Levels Impact the Sale of My Home?

    Having excessive radon concentrations may influence your home sale. Home buyers today are more conscious of radon risks and may ask for testing or mitigation before finalizing the sale. Excessive radon readings may decrease your property value, extend the closing timeline, or discourage potential buyers altogether. It's advisable to handle radon problems early to ensure occupant safety, satisfy disclosure standards, and preserve your home's appeal to buyers.
